  • Patent number: 5888462
    Abstract: A method of solvent extraction of a nickel sulfate solution uses a multi-stage, counter-current, organic solvent extraction system composed of at least two extractors connected in series, and includes a first extraction step of feeding a crude nickel sulfate solution that contains sodium and ammonium impurities into a second-stage extractor, wherein it is treated in countercurrent flow and at a pH of 6.5 to 7.0 with an organic extractant fed into the second-stage extractor from the first-stage extractor, to thereby extract some of nickel in the crude nickel sulfate solution into the organic extractant; and a second extraction step of transferring the nickel-containing, organic phase to an organic phase-scrubbing step to remove sodium and ammonium, while transferring the nickel sulfate solution, from the first extraction step and from which some of nickel has been removed, to the first-stage extractor, wherein it is treated in countercurrent flow and at a pH of 5.5 to 6.

  • Patent number: 5660866
    Abstract: The invention relates to a combination popsicle wherein an ice layer whose surface is uneven is formed on the circumference of a core stuff, a method for making the same and a device for the method. As an ice material for forming the ice layer, irregular ice crystals in size are used which is provided by collecting uniformly dispersed fine ice crystals in a cohering process to form into lumps and by crushing the lumps. Because of this, with the irregular ice crystals, uneven form which is clear can be constantly formed on the surface of the ice, popsicle.
